DuncinToffee · 22/07/2026 15:44

The ex-CEO of Southern Water faces a charge of conspiracy to defraud alongside three other former employees, it can now be reported.

Matthew Wright is accused of trying to cheat wastewater testing rules under the Operator Self-Monitoring (OSM) compliance regime.
